Design of an Integrated Complex Filter System for RF Applications Using Log-domain Filtering

Abstract/Summary:
This thesis demonstrates the development of a current-mode system that integrates a front end mixer, an intermediate complex filter and a back end demodulation block, based on the theory of log domain filtering and the technique of state-space synthesis. The unique features of this system involve: (1) it is realized only with BJTs, current sources, capacitors and no op amps; (2) the intermediate complex filter is designed according to a specific state-space description and it integrates a multiple input and multiple output second-order band pass filter that is conveniently and precisely tunable in both Q and fc; (3) the topology of each block and the whole system is implemented with great symmetry, which is preferable in IC layout.
